When will I ovulate after a miscarriage?

Women commonly anticipate their first ovulation and menstrual cycle after experiencing a miscarriage. According to ACOG, women may ovulate as soon as two to four weeks after a miscarriage within the first 13 weeks of pregnancy. If the miscarriage occurs later, it may take longer for hormonal levels to return to baseline, and ovulation may be delayed.

If resumption of menstrual cycles has not occurred after eight weeks, it is advisable to notify your OBGYN.
